Hull is a city located in Madison County Georgia. Hull has a 2024 population of 235. Hull is currently growing at a rate of 0.43% annually and its population has increased by 0.86% since the most recent census, which recorded a population of 233 in 2020.

The average household income in Hull is $63,710 with a poverty rate of 22.5%. The median rental costs in recent years comes to - per month, and the median house value is -. The median age in Hull is 38.3 years, 44.3 years for males, and 27.3 years for females.

75.69% of Hull residents speak only English, while 24.31% speak other languages. The non-English language spoken by the largest group is Spanish, which is spoken by 24.31% of the population.

Poverty in Hull

The race most likely to be in poverty in Hull is Black, with 42.5% below the poverty level.

The race least likely to be in poverty in Hull is White, with 29.17% below the poverty level.

The poverty rate among those that worked full-time for the past 12 months was 0%. Among those working part-time, it was 17.24%, and for those that did not work, the poverty rate was 32.58%.

75.61% of Hull residents were born in the United States, with 70.73% having been born in Georgia. 21.46% of residents are not US citizens. Of those not born in the United States, the largest percentage are from Latin America.
